    Description

    Description

    •    Develop advanced CMOS image sensor (CIS) process to meet performance targets under a defined schedule and budget.
    •    Collaborate with foundry partners to define and improve the CIS silicon, color and package process for each CIS technology.
    •    Provide support to production and design teams to improve yield and overall sensor performance, establishing process flow applicable to mass production.
    •    Design and manage silicon split lots with respect to project goals and schedules to achieve performance targets, meet production requirements, and research and development of future technologies.
    •    Analyze and interpret large volumes of bench and wafer level data; feedback to pixel and wafer split design to optimize design and improve performance.
    •    Work in close collaboration with internal pixel design and characterization engineers, and external foundry partners; primary liaison between internal and external teams to drive effective technical communication and discussion.
    •    Work with characterization engineers to analyze data and test results, provide feedback on evaluation methods and settings to improve testing efficiency and accuracy; coordinate evaluation schedule and equipment to enable testing.
    •    Continuously track technology improvement and state of art developed by foundry; select and implement appropriate fabrication processes to meet CIS performance and yield targets; closely monitor lot processing and swiftly address/feedback any issues to foundry to mitigate product loss and schedule delay. 
    Requirements:
    Master’s degree or foreign equivalent deg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or a related field.
    Two years of experience in developing and fabricating semiconductor devices.
    Required experience or skills in: 
    •    Developing and fabricating semiconductor devices, including designing and managing experimental splits to achieve performance targets. 
    •    Photolithography and microfabrication techniques (electron beam, thermal deposition, sputtering, reactive ion etching) in a clean room environment. 
    •    Silicon and semiconductor device testing, including electron microscopy (SEM, TEM), atomic force microscopy (AFM), spectroscopy techniques (photo- and fluoro- luminescence, Fourier transform IR spectroscopy, UV-vis), and optical and electrical device characterization. 
    •    Defining project roadmaps, performance targets, and schedules. 
    Annual base salary for this role in California, US is expected to be between $156,853 - $160,000. Actual pay will be determined on a number of factors such as relevant skills and experience, and the pay of employees in the similar role.

    About Company

    OmniVision Technologies is a leading developer of advanced digital imaging solutions. Its award-winning CMOS imaging technology enables superior image quality in many of today’s consumer and commercial applications, including mobile phones, notebooks, tablets and webcams, digital still and video cameras, security and surveillance, entertainment devices, automotive and medical imaging systems.
